A Family-Friendly Day in Udaipur

9:00AM: City Palace

Start your day at the magnificent City Palace, a grand complex overlooking Lake Pichola. Explore the stunning architecture, intricate artwork, and beautiful gardens. Don't miss the Crystal Gallery, which houses a remarkable collection of crystal items. Admission fee: INR 300 per adult, INR 100 per child.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.

12:00PM: Jag Mandir

Take a boat ride to Jag Mandir, an enchanting island palace on Lake Pichola. Enjoy the serene surroundings and marvel at the exquisite design of the palace. You can have a delightful lunch at the on-site restaurant. Boat ride fee: INR 300 per person. Estimated time spent: 2 hours.

2:30PM: Saheliyon Ki Bari

Visit Saheliyon Ki Bari, a beautiful garden adorned with fountains, kiosks, marble elephants, and a delightful lotus pool. This place was built for the royal ladies to relax and enjoy leisure time. Admission fee: INR 10 per person.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.

4:30PM: Bagore Ki Haveli

Explore the Bagore Ki Haveli, a historic mansion converted into a museum. Witness traditional Rajasthani art, costumes, and artifacts. Don't miss the cultural show featuring folk dances and music in the evening. Admission fee: INR 100 per adult, INR 25 per child.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.

6:30PM: Lake Pichola Boat Ride

End your day with a scenic boat ride on Lake Pichola. Enjoy the breathtaking views of Udaipur's architectural marvels, including the Lake Palace and Jag Mandir. The boat ride allows you to witness the city's beauty during sunset. Boat ride fee: INR 400 per person. Estimated time spent: 1 hour.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, consider visiting Shilpgram, a rural arts and crafts complex showcasing the rich cultural heritage of Rajasthan. Here, you can witness traditional folk performances, explore handicrafts, and interact with local artisans. It's a great opportunity to immerse yourself in the local culture and support the artisans' livelihoods while enjoying a family-friendly environment.
